Inspira Enterprise Expands into Australia to Accelerate AI - Driven
SYDNEY, Aug. 24,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Inspira Enterprise, a global leader in cybersecurity, AI and digital transformation services, today announced its strategic expansion into Australia, reinforcing its commitment to helping organizations strengthen cyber resilience, secure AI adoption, and modernize enterprise security operations across the Asia-Pacific region. With a growing demand for cyber resilience, identity security, AI governance, cloud security, and managed detection and response (MDR), Australia represents a significant milestone in Inspira's global growth journey. The expansion will enable Australian enterprises and government organizations to leverage Inspira's deep expertise in delivering outcome-driven cybersecurity services backed by AI-powered innovation. "Australia is one of the world's most digitally advanced economies, with organizations accelerating AI adoption while navigating an increasingly sophisticated cyber threat landscape," said Josef Figueroa, President - ASEAN, Inspira Enterprise.
